Intricate molecular machineries, such as the ESCRT protein complexes, are well known for their ability to cut biological membranes. The discovery that membranes can also be severed by phase-separated condensates, through line tension force, reveals a previously unknown mechanism of membrane fission that highlights the fundamental role of condensates in cellular organization.
